MERCY CRYSTAL LAKE HOSPITAL AND MEDICAL CENTER INC, founded in 2014, is a mid-sized nonprofit in the Health Care sector that reported $50.1M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 50%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$56.4M exceeded revenue, resulting in a 12% operating deficit.

Mission

TO IMPROVE AND PROTECT THE HEALTH AND WELFARE OF THE COMMUNITY IN ACCORDANCE WITH OUR MISSION, THE MISSION OF MERCY CRYSTAL LAKE HOSPITAL AND MEDICAL CENTER, INC IS "EXCEPTIONAL HEALTH CARE SERVICES WITH A PASSION FOR MAKING LIVES BETTER". THE FOUNDATION OF THIS MISSION IS BASED ON A VISION OF QUALITY: EXCELLENCE IN PATIENT CARE; SERVICE: EXCEPTIONAL PATIENT AND CUSTOMER CARE; PARTNERING: BEST PLACE TO WORK; AND COST: COST-EFFECTIVE CARE ALONG WITH A COMMITMENT TO THE VALUES OF: HEALING IN THE BROADEST SENSE, PATIENTS COME FIRST, TREAT EACH OTHER LIKE FAMILY AND ALWAYS SEEK EXCELLENCE.
